Solution Overview

Problem

Shipping providers face challenges in managing vehicle operator tasks due to varying geographic regions with different regulations, making it difficult to generate, modify, and collect data associated with task completion.

Innovation Solution

A workflow management system that allows administrators to generate and manage customized vehicle operator workflows, including the designation of tasks, triggering conditions, and integration with third-party applications for task completion and evidence submission.

Data Source

PatentUS12263846B1Customized vehicle operator workflows
Publication Date: 2025.04.01 SAMSARA INC

AI summary

Disclosed are systems, methods, and non-transitory computer-readable media for customized vehicle operator workflows. A vehicle operator workflow includes a set of tasks to be completed by a vehicle operator. The vehicle operator workflow may be presented to the vehicle operator upon satisfaction of a triggering event, such as upon the vehicle operator logging into an account or the vehicle entering a specified geographic region. The vehicle operator workflow may enable the vehicle operator to complete the individual tasks as well as submit evidence that the tasks have been completed.
